on development, nuances, and looping
- older characters who have a history of being ruthless and bossy leaders (sayid jarrah, dumbledore, iroh) and in the present narrative seem like people who exercise emotions and their caring for people actively are usually matured extjs
- being damaged does not change your mbti type it just changes how you exercise it, e.g. a damaged enfp can be insecure on who they are and mistrustful of others
- while isfjs are commonly labeled as "defenders" (and from my perspective, usually sensitive and anxious characters), when they loop they get extremely closed off, withdrawn/cold, and hyper-judgmental, e.g. petunia from harry potter
- Ne doms (enfp, entp) no matter what aspect of their growth will always feel as comfortable by themselves and alone as they do with people
- in this vein, Si users (notably istjs) actually actively seek to be useful or part of a whole, and have a willingness and can prolong long periods of time interacting with others especially if they are helping with them
